Q: Is 617,614 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 617,614 is a composite number.

Why is 617,614 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 617,614 can be evenly divided by 1 2 19 38 16,253 32,506 308,807 and 617,614, with no remainder.

Since 617,614 cannot be divided by just 1 and 617,614, it is a composite number.
